APA Style for Academic Writing

Course Description

 

Learning Objectives

  1. Identify key components of APA Style (7th edition) used in educational writing, including formatting, citations, and references.
  2. Format academic papers in APA Style, including title pages, headers, in-text citations, and reference lists.
  3. Accurately cite a variety of sources, such as books, journal articles, websites, and multimedia, using APA conventions.
  4. Integrate research and evidence into written work while avoiding plagiarism through proper paraphrasing and source attribution.
  5. Apply APA writing standards to assignments such as essays, lesson plans, discussion posts, and research papers in the field of education.
  6. Use digital tools and resources (e.g., citation generators, style guides) to support APA formatting and editing.
  7. Demonstrate increased confidence and independence in producing polished, publication-ready educational writing.
